I've had the Venture X for 1.5 years now, and I'm not thrilled with the value of the points. I understand why you'd value them equally, but compared to Chase, Citi, and Amex, it seems there are fewer transfer bonuses. Transfer bonuses have significantly boosted my return on investment with points, and it feels like Capital One hasn't been as lucrative for that reason. It's hard to quantify, since historical transfer deals don't predict future ones, but it feels like it's the case.
It's a real bummer, too, because my main reason for Capital One was to get Turkish Miles, and they devalued the 45k NA to Europe 2 awards a month before I earned my signup bonus.
